Why Annual Heat Pump Tune-Ups are Indispensable for Mt. Washington Homes

Investing in a yearly heat pump tune-up offers a multitude of benefits that extend beyond immediate comfort, impacting your system’s longevity, your energy bills, and your home’s safety.

  • Optimal Performance and Energy Efficiency: Over time, dirt, dust, and wear can diminish your heat pump's efficiency. A professional tune-up addresses these issues, ensuring your system doesn't have to work harder than necessary. This translates directly to lower energy consumption, helping to reduce your utility bills while maintaining your desired indoor temperature. For Mt. Washington homeowners, this means efficient cooling during humid summers and effective heating during cold winters.
  • Extended System Lifespan: A heat pump is a significant investment in your home. Regular maintenance helps identify and rectify minor issues before they escalate into major problems that could lead to premature system failure. By keeping all components in top working order, a tune-up extends the operational life of your heat pump, maximizing your return on investment.
  • Enhanced Reliability and Fewer Breakdowns: The last thing any homeowner wants is a heat pump failure during extreme weather. Tune-ups are preventative, designed to catch potential issues like loose electrical connections, low refrigerant, or worn parts before they cause an inconvenient and often costly breakdown. This proactive approach significantly enhances your system's reliability, minimizing the risk of emergency repairs.
  • Consistent Indoor Comfort: A well-maintained heat pump delivers consistent heating and cooling throughout your home. Tune-ups ensure proper airflow, balanced temperatures, and optimal humidity control, creating a more comfortable living environment for everyone in your Mt. Washington residence.
  • Maintaining Warranty Validity: Many heat pump manufacturers stipulate that regular professional maintenance is a condition for keeping your warranty valid. Neglecting routine tune-ups could void your coverage, leaving you responsible for the full cost of repairs if a major component fails. A documented service history from certified technicians confirms your adherence to these requirements.
  • Safety Assurance: Heat pumps involve electrical components and refrigerants. During a tune-up, technicians inspect these elements for any potential hazards, such as frayed wires or refrigerant leaks, ensuring the safe operation of your system and the well-being of your household.

What Does a Professional Heat Pump Tune-Up Include?

A thorough heat pump tune-up performed by skilled, NATE-certified technicians involves a meticulous multi-point inspection and cleaning process, designed to optimize every aspect of your system’s operation. This comprehensive service covers both the indoor and outdoor units and their interconnected components.

  • Inspect and Clean Coils: Both the indoor evaporator coil and the outdoor condenser coil are crucial for heat transfer. Dirt and debris on these coils act as insulation, impeding their ability to exchange heat efficiently. Technicians meticulously clean these coils, ensuring unimpeded airflow and optimal thermal exchange, which is vital for both heating and cooling performance.
  • Check Refrigerant Levels and Pressure: The refrigerant is the lifeblood of your heat pump, absorbing and releasing heat as it cycles through the system. Technicians verify the refrigerant charge to ensure it's at the manufacturer's specified level. Incorrect refrigerant levels, whether too high or too low, can drastically reduce efficiency, cause the system to work harder, and potentially lead to compressor damage.
  • Examine Electrical Connections: Loose or corroded electrical connections can cause intermittent operation, system failures, and even fire hazards. All electrical terminals, wiring, and contactors are inspected and tightened as necessary, ensuring safe and reliable power flow throughout the unit.
  • Lubricate Moving Parts: Motors and bearings within the heat pump have moving parts that require proper lubrication to prevent friction and wear. Technicians apply appropriate lubricants to extend the life of these components and ensure smooth, quiet operation.
  • Inspect Blower Assembly: The indoor blower fan is responsible for circulating conditioned air throughout your home. During a tune-up, the blower motor, fan blades, and housing are inspected for cleanliness and proper function. Dust and debris on the blower can reduce airflow and lead to inefficient heating or cooling.
  • Verify Thermostat Calibration: The thermostat is the control center of your HVAC system. Technicians check its calibration to ensure it's accurately reading and maintaining your desired temperatures. A miscalibrated thermostat can lead to inconsistent comfort and wasted energy.
  • Check Condensate Drain: The condensate drain line removes moisture collected during the cooling process. Blockages in this line can lead to water leaks, water damage, and even mold growth. Technicians inspect and clear the drain, ensuring proper drainage and preventing potential issues.
  • Inspect Ductwork: The duct system is critical for delivering conditioned air efficiently. Technicians conduct a visual inspection of accessible ductwork for any obvious leaks, disconnections, or damage that could lead to air loss and reduced system efficiency.
  • Test Safety Controls: Heat pumps are equipped with various safety mechanisms designed to protect the system and your home. These controls are tested to ensure they are functioning correctly, providing an extra layer of protection against malfunctions.
  • Assess Air Filter Condition: While homeowners can typically change air filters, technicians will assess the existing filter's condition and advise on the appropriate type and replacement schedule for optimal indoor air quality and system performance.
  • Measure Temperature Differential: By measuring the temperature of the air entering and exiting the system, technicians can gauge the heat pump's effectiveness in heating or cooling your home, ensuring it meets performance specifications.
  • Comprehensive System Evaluation: Beyond these specific checks, a NATE-certified technician provides an overall assessment of your heat pump's health, identifying any signs of wear, potential future issues, and offering insights into its operational efficiency.

When to Schedule Your Heat Pump Tune-Up in Mt. Washington

For homes in Mt. Washington, the ideal timing for a heat pump tune-up can vary slightly depending on how you use your system. Since heat pumps provide both heating and cooling, an annual tune-up is typically recommended.

To best prepare for the demands of each season, many experts suggest scheduling a tune-up in the spring, before the cooling season begins, or in the fall, ahead of the heating season. This proactive approach ensures your system is clean, calibrated, and ready to perform efficiently when it's needed most. If your heat pump is working extra hard year-round or if it’s an older unit, some homeowners opt for semi-annual maintenance – one check-up in the spring and another in the fall – to maximize efficiency and reliability.
